Cattle Dog mix male puppy
Welcome George from Kern County Animal Services. By shelter standards, this guy was in for a while. Someone must have liked him and kept him alive long enough for us to scoop him to safety.
He’s in foster with an awesome family, ranch style. So far here is what they report:
“George is super cute, playful and adventurous. He’s snuggly and loves people. He plays well with other dogs but not quite ready to share food yet. He’s got super cool coat coloring and at 29lbs, is the perfect size. So far he’s been pretty quiet. He’s going to make someone a great dog!”
George is a 10-12 month old cattle dog mix. He is microchipped, UTD on vaccines, and will be getting scheduled for a neuter shortly. Located in San Luis Obispo, CA
